ANALYTICAL METHOD DEVELOPMENT AND VALIDATION OF RP-HPLC AND SIMULTANEOUS ESTIMATION OF MOXONIDINE IN PHARMACEUTICAL DOSAGE FORM
Shivani S. Yendhe*, Shubham S. Pate, Hemant V. Kamble, Ashwini K. Andhale and Santosh A. Waghmare
ABSTRACT A simple, sensitive, and selective isocratic reversed phase High Performance Liquid chromatographic method has been developed for estimation of moxonidine from pharmaceutical dosage form using a mobile phase consisting mixture Methanol: Water (80:20), at the flow rate of 0.8mL/min . A cosmosil C18 A (250mm X 4.6 mm, 5micron particle diameter) column was used as a stationary phase. The retention time of moxinidine 2.09 min. the eluent were detected at 252nm. The proposed method is precise, accurate, selective and rapid for the determination of Moxonidine. Keywords: Moxonidine, RP-HPLC Method, Mobile phase. [Download Article] [Download Certifiate] |
